The Lanesborough is a distinguished hotel situated in the heart of London, United Kingdom. This refined establishment is renowned for its exceptional blend of 19th-century grandeur and contemporary elegance, presenting a distinguished setting that attracts guests from around the globe. Positioned at the prestigious address overlooking Hyde Park, The Lanesborough offers its guests an enviable location within easy reach of London’s renowned landmarks, high-end shopping districts, and cultural attractions.

As part of the Oetker Collection, the hotel prides itself on a heritage of refined hospitality, providing unparalleled service and luxurious amenities to ensure a memorable stay. The interior design, crafted by the acclaimed Alberto Pinto, exudes a timeless charm with its opulent furnishings and intricate detailing, reflecting the classic Regency aesthetic.

Dining at The Lanesborough is an exquisite experience in itself. Featuring the acclaimed restaurant Céleste, which showcases a menu inspired by modern British cuisine with European influences, guests are treated to culinary excellence. The intimate and stylish Library Bar offers a charming ambience, perfect for enjoying a fine selection of wines, spirits, and cocktails crafted by expert mixologists.

Moreover, The Lanesborough extends its luxury beyond conventional boundaries with its exclusive club and wellness facilities. The Lanesborough Club & Spa provides a sanctuary of relaxation and rejuvenation, offering a comprehensive array of treatments and services tailored to enhance well-being.

Ultimately, The Lanesborough stands as an epitome of luxury, serving as a sanctuary for those seeking a unique experience defined by superior service, historical elegance, and modern comfort in the vibrant city of London.

About London

London offers a rich tapestry of experiences that cater to a variety of interests. For those interested in history, a visit to the British Museum is essential. This institution houses a vast collection of art and antiquities from around the world, allowing visitors to explore human history through its artifacts.

Another significant historical site is the Tower of London, where you can learn about its storied past, view the Crown Jewels, and understand its role in British history. Nearby, the Houses of Parliament and Big Ben provide an iconic glimpse into the country’s political life, and guided tours are available to deepen your understanding.

For art enthusiasts, the National Gallery and the Tate Modern offer impressive collections of classic and contemporary works, respectively. The Victoria and Albert Museum is also worth a visit, showcasing a diverse range of decorative arts and design.

If you prefer outdoor spaces, Hyde Park is one of London’s largest green spaces, perfect for a leisurely stroll or a picnic. The Royal Botanic Gardens at Kew provide a more specialized botanical experience with its stunning plant collections and beautiful landscapes.

Shopping can be experienced in various forms, from the luxury boutiques of Bond Street to the vibrant markets of Camden and Portobello Road, each offering unique finds and local culture.

The culinary scene in London is diverse, with options ranging from traditional British fare to international cuisine. Exploring the Borough Market provides an opportunity to taste local produce and artisanal foods, while numerous restaurants across the city cater to every palate.

The vibrant neighborhoods of Soho, Covent Garden, and Shoreditch offer a mix of shops, entertainment, and nightlife, making them popular spots for both locals and visitors. The West End is renowned for its theatre productions, where one can enjoy a variety of performances, from classic plays to modern musicals.

Lastly, taking a stroll along the Thames River provides not only picturesque views but also a chance to discover landmarks such as the London Eye and Shakespeare’s Globe, enhancing the experience of this historic city. Each of these activities contributes to a well-rounded visit, reflecting the diverse culture and history of London.
